Course Information for the Sea Kayak and Paddler Wilderness First Aid

Sponsored by the Bellingham Bay Community Boating Center, this Sea Kayak and Paddler specific Wilderness First Aid course is a 16 hour course designed to provide elementary skills in remote and marine environment patient care. Based on recommendations from the Wilderness Medical Society and evidence-based research, our curriculum focuses on making sound decisions regarding the treatment of illnesses and injuries in the marine environment and will focus on ocean-based hazards and scenarios. This course is a hands-on, experiential format providing students with the skills and confidence for making remote medical care decisions. Sea Kayak and Paddler Wilderness First Aid is ideal for anybody spending time on the water.
